李少偉 曹成濤



摘 ?要:傳統的路徑規劃未充分考慮出行者行車習慣和復雜交通環境的影響,通常搜索到的路徑不一定符合出行者預期,本文將影響出行者路徑選擇的多種因素進行分析,運用層次分析法(AHP)建立了行程時間最短的出行者道路綜合權值模型,并結合交通規則及實際道路環境使用A*算法進行最優路徑分析,通過廣州市天河區部分道路進行實例驗證,結果證明了本文算法的有效性。
關鍵詞:最優路徑;A*算法;交通規則;道路權值
中圖分類號:TP312 ? ? ?文獻標識碼:A
Abstract:Traditional path planning does not fully consider the influence of traveler's driving habits and complex traffic environment.Usually the searched path does not necessarily meet the traveler's expectations.This paper analyzes the various factors affecting the traveler's path selection,and adopts Analytic Hierarchy Process (AHP) to establish the model of the comprehensive road weight for the traveler with the shortest travel time.A* algorithm is used to analyze the optimal path in combination with the traffic rules and the actual road environment.Example verification is conducted on some roads in Tianhe District of Guangzhou.The results have proven the effectiveness of the proposed algorithm.
Keywords:optimal path;A* algorithm;traffic rules;road weight
1 ? 引言(Introduction)
隨著移動地理信息系統(GIS)技術、全球衛星定位(GPS)技術、無線通信技術的迅猛發展和廣泛應用,出行者利用移動智能終端進行路徑誘導的行為越來越普遍。最優路徑問題是智能交通系統(Intelligent Transportation System,ITS)中路徑誘導子系統(Route Guidance System,RGS)的核心問題[1],傳統最優路徑搜索主要依據道路等級進行,未充分顧及出行者行車習慣和復雜交通環境的影響,得到的路徑往往只考慮距離最短,結果通常包含擁擠的道路、過多紅綠燈等,不符合出行者預期,因此,規劃符合出行者行車習慣的行程,不但能提高出行者的行車效率和駕駛體驗,也能緩解城市交通擁堵壓力,具有重要的現實意義。
2 ? 城市道路網絡模型(Urban road network model)
最優路徑分析本質屬于圖論研究中的一個經典問題,但在實際應用中,需要結合交通規則和實際道路環境,將其抽象為有現實意義的城市道路網絡模型。
城市交通的快速發展,使得城市道路網除了具有一般道路網的特點之外,還有其特殊之處:①路段及節點眾多,對于大型城市來說,城市道路及交叉口數量多而復雜;②道路網絡密集且結構復雜,多車道、單行線、轉彎限制、限速車道、交通管制、立交系統等交通特征和新的越來越多的交通規則使得城市道路網的結構變得越來越復雜[2]。
①路況,通過百度地圖API獲取城市道路擁堵情況,分為暢通、緩行、擁擠、嚴重擁堵四種通行狀態,道路擁堵情況在時間上表現出明顯的周期性,由于道路擁堵程度的易變性,對于出行時間較長的路況預測需要綜合實時交通信息和歷史交通信息。
②道路等級,城市道路等級分為快速路(高速公路市內路段)、主干道、次干道、支路四類,道路設計行車速度依次降低。
③路口延誤,包括紅綠燈等待時間、通行延誤時間等,人們因為交通擁堵等待交通燈消耗的時間越來越長[7]。
④車道數量,通常將車道數分為四類:4車道及以上、2或3車道、1車道、0車道。
依據圖1的層次結構圖,運用Saaty的1—9及其倒數作為標度的方法構造Ci對目標W的相對重要性判斷矩陣,本文參考文獻[6]多位專家對道路屬性指標的評價意見,給出判斷矩陣元素的值,判斷矩陣W-C及特征向量如表1所示。
由表3和表4可見,因為實際交通環境不同,道路綜合權值并未完全按道路等級劃分,傳統靜態的最短路徑和道路綜合權值下的最優路徑并非同一條路徑,后者得到的路徑未必是距離最短的,但一定是考慮了路況等多種影響因素的最優路徑,出行體驗更好。
6 ? 結論(Conclusion)
自駕出行已成為出行者主要出行方式之一,如何合理的規劃路徑減少行程時間是出行者關注的重要話題。本文針對城市道路網的特點,將影響出行者路徑選擇的多種因素進行分析,運用層次分析法建立基于行程時間的出行者道路綜合權值模型,并結合交通規則及實際道路環境使用A*算法進行最優路徑分析,通過廣州市天河區部分道路進行驗證,相較于傳統最佳路徑分析結果,本文提出的最優路徑算法不僅滿足復雜交通環境下的交通規則約束,而且搜索出的最優路徑更加符合出行者行車習慣和實際情況。
參考文獻(References)
[1] 潘義勇,孫璐.隨機交通網絡環境下自適應最可靠路徑問題[J].吉林大學學報(工學版),2014,44(6):1622-1627.
[2] 朱慶,李淵.2007道路網絡模型研究綜述[J].武漢大學學報(信息科學版),2007,32(06):471-476.
[3] Bekhor S,Ben-Akiva M E,Scott Ramming M.Adaptation of logit kernel to route choice situation[J].Transportation Research Record: Journal of the Transportation Research Board,2002,1805(1):78-85.
[4] 高明霞.道路交通網絡最短路徑關鍵轉向研究[J].公路,2018(9):199-202.
[5] 孫秋霞,孫璐,劉新民.基于出行個體行為的交通網絡效率研究[J].重慶交通大學學報(自然科學版),2016,35(2):110-113.
[6] 段麗瓊,劉立國.應用層次分析法確定道路屬性指標的權重[J].海洋測繪,2004,24(3):44-46.
[7] 朱云虹,袁一.基于改進A*算法的最優路徑搜索[J].計算機技術與發展,2018,28(4):55-59.
[8] 阮于洲,蔣捷.基于層次分析法的路段屬性求權方法[J].地理信息世界,2004,2(2):44-48.
[9] 王少帥,蔡忠亮,任福.加權路網分層的最優路徑計算[J].測繪科學,2015,40(3):127-131;122.
[10] 歐陽圣,胡望宇.幾種經典搜索算法研究與應用[J].計算機系統應用,2011,20(5):243-247.
作者簡介:
李少偉(1981-),男,碩士,講師.研究領域:GIS/GPS在智能交通中的應用.
曹成濤(1981-),男,博士,教授.研究領域:智能交通技術.